Montgomery Sheriff's Office to host 10th annual Easter egg hunt
DAYTON, Ohio (WDTN) – The 10th annual Montgomery County Sheriff's Office Police Athletic & Activities League Easter egg hunt is coming up soon.
The PAAL egg hunt will be Saturday, April 19, at the Montgomery County Fairgrounds. Registration will start at 10:30 a.m., with the hunt beginning at 11 a.m.
There will be over 3,000 eggs for kids to collect and a special visit from the Easter Bunny.

Montgomery County Sheriff Rob Streck called the event a wonderful opportunity.
'We are thrilled to host this event for the 10th year in a row, bringing joy to the children and families of our community,' said Streck. 'This is a wonderful opportunity for families to come together, enjoy some Easter fun, and connect with our deputies and the PAAL team.'
The PAAL program exists to develop positive relationships between law enforcement and local youth. For more information, click here.
